// PINNED_DEPS_MANIFEST_VERSION
//
// Hey newcomers: we pin every dependency exactly — no carets, no tildes.
// Yes, it's annoying. No, we won't change it; the Quillstack outage taught
// us that "minor" bumps aren't. Update pins only via the weekly bump job,
// never by hand. The manifest schema was frozen at the build stamped below.

pipeline stamp: htk4_ae36

☐ Dependency pinning sign-off (key ceremony step 4). Quick context for new contractors: at Brightlane we pin every dependency to an exact version in the Tollgate manifest — no ranges, no wildcards, ever. Upgrades go through the Wedgewood review board, which meets Tuesdays. During the ceremony you'll verify the signed lockfile matches the build attestation before the signing key leaves escrow. It's tedious but it keeps supply-chain surprises out. Once the lockfile checks out, unlock the ceremony key shard with the passphrase below.

recovery phrase for bajef-yagag: zordor-casok-tammir

## Build Provenance: Trailmark Offline Mode

This page documents provenance for the offline mode shipped in the Trailmark field-survey app. All offline-capable builds are produced by the Deerholt signing pipeline, which embeds the sync-schema version and the commit tag into the artifact manifest. Before approving a release, the release manager must confirm the manifest matches the pipeline log and that no local builds were promoted. The provenance token for the candidate build under review is recorded immediately below.

build token for kagaf-hahof: htk14_9d3d4d26d7d8de

The Loyalo ledger service is built exclusively through the Bramwick pipeline; manual builds are not accepted into the release channel. Each build embeds the commit hash, the lockfile digest, and the signing identity of the pipeline itself. Contractors verifying a deployment should fetch the provenance record from the attestation store and confirm all three fields match the running binary. Mismatches must be reported before any traffic is routed. The attestation for the current release carries the token shown below.

build token for fajof-yahof: htk4_869f